Before you start cleaning, be sure which type of oven you have: conventional, continuous or self cleaning oven. Each type has its own unique cleaning and maintenance procedures. See www.oven-cleaning-guide.com. This answer is for conventional oven only! Oven cleaners can be divided into two main groups, those that work and those that don’t! Alkaline and thick oven cleaners are usually in the group that works! (these are mostly commercial oven cleaners). But it’s not just the oven cleaner you use that counts (I’m using WellDone oven cleaner), the cleaning procedure is also very important: If the oven is heavily soiled, you may need to use aggressive means such as powerful oven cleaner (alkaline), Schoch-Brite pad, plastic scrapper, Paper-towel, two pieces of cloth and heating up the oven to 50c/120f.
